From the blurb:

Thirty-something bandmates, Nolan Metcalf and Ellis Bloom, have been there for each other through thick and thin. So when a life-changing event sends Ellis to the safety of Nolan’s apartment, he’s grateful for the comfort his best friend provides. They’ve never done anything resembling cuddling and sleepovers before, but Ellis finds he needs it just the same.

Soul-deep conversations and tender moments transform into a passion that shocks them both. Since neither has ever entertained the idea of being with another man, they attribute their confusing feelings to their established nightly routine. Determined to spend time apart, they resume their solo lives. But the desperate, achy neediness only returns, and soon enough they’re back in each other’s arms—and beds.

Before they have time to work through it, the real world intrudes. Admitting their secret status would change not only the chemistry of their band but the trajectory of their lives. Plus, their newfound feelings seem as fragile as the beginning notes of a new melody. They’ll need to rely on the solid foundation of their friendship, and even then, it could all fall apart. Will they become a one-hit wonder or a love song that endures the test of time?

*TW: Discussions of past child abuse and a home invasion involving weapons




Miki J's Review:

Superb... Absolutely superb!! Love Song is a beautifully written book about normal guys who play in a band and are friends. 

After a traumatic incident, two of them become more... so much more... quite to their surprise!! 

It's sweet and adorable and oh so totally organic how their relationship evolved - totally a GFY-double tale - and will have you swooning and sighing and cheering... that song - heart-melting wonderful... had me in tears. 

This book is quite simply... WONDERFUL!!

Rating: 5 Stars
